Introduction
Woven stainless steel mesh isn’t limited to filtration—it also plays a critical role in modern architecture, safety, and industrial security systems. Its strength, durability, weather resistance, and aesthetics make it an increasingly popular choice among architects and engineers.
In this blog, we explore the growing applications of woven mesh beyond filtration and sieving.

Why Woven Mesh is Ideal for Architecture & Safety
1. High Strength & Durability
Woven mesh withstands tensile stress and impact.
2. Weather & Corrosion Resistance
Perfect for outdoor structures, facades, and barriers.
3. Aesthetic Appeal
Gives a modern industrial look.
4. Fire Resistance
Safer than plastic or synthetic panels.
5. Low Maintenance
Easy to clean, anti-rust, long-lasting.
Top Applications in Architecture
1. Facades & Wall Cladding
Woven mesh provides:
- Sun regulation
- Ventilation
- Aesthetic texture
- Protection from debris
2. Staircases & Balustrades
Used for internal & external railings.
3. Decorative Partitions & Interior Design
Modern offices and commercial spaces use mesh for partitions.

Safety & Industrial Applications
1. Machine Guards
Protect workers from moving machinery.
2. Security Mesh for Windows & Doors
High-strength mesh protects commercial sites and homes.
3. Safety Barriers & Fencing
Used in factories, warehouses, construction sites.
Ventilation & Airflow Control
Woven mesh allows airflow while blocking debris, making it ideal for:
- HVAC systems
- Generator rooms
- Industrial ventilation
- Trench covers
